มัณฑนากรในเชิงมุมคืออะไร?
มัณฑนากรในเชิงมุมคืออะไร?

วีดีโอ: มัณฑนากรในเชิงมุมคืออะไร?

วีดีโอ: มัณฑนากรในเชิงมุมคืออะไร?
วีดีโอ: Decorators part -1| Types of Decorators | Configuration of Meta-data| Angular 8 tutorials 2024, อาจ
Anonim

สิ่งที่เป็น มัณฑนากร ? มัณฑนากร เป็นรูปแบบการออกแบบที่ใช้ในการแยกการปรับเปลี่ยนหรือตกแต่งคลาสโดยไม่ต้องแก้ไขซอร์สโค้ดต้นฉบับ ใน AngularJS , มัณฑนากร เป็นฟังก์ชันที่อนุญาตให้แก้ไขบริการ คำสั่ง หรือตัวกรองก่อนใช้งาน

นอกจากนี้ มัณฑนากรในเชิงมุม 4 คืออะไร?

มัณฑนากร เป็นคุณลักษณะใหม่ของ TypeScript และใช้ตลอดทั้ง เชิงมุม รหัส แต่พวกเขาไม่มีอะไรต้องกลัว กับ มัณฑนากร เราสามารถกำหนดค่าและปรับแต่งชั้นเรียนของเราได้ในเวลาออกแบบ เป็นเพียงฟังก์ชันที่สามารถใช้เพื่อเพิ่มข้อมูลเมตา คุณสมบัติ หรือฟังก์ชันให้กับสิ่งที่เชื่อมต่ออยู่

ข้างบนนี้ มัณฑนากรในเชิงมุม 2 คืออะไร? มัณฑนากร เป็นฟังก์ชันที่เรียกใช้ด้วยสัญลักษณ์ @ นำหน้า และตามด้วยคลาส พารามิเตอร์ เมธอด หรือคุณสมบัติทันที NS มัณฑนากร ฟังก์ชั่นได้รับข้อมูลเกี่ยวกับคลาส พารามิเตอร์หรือเมธอดและ มัณฑนากร ฟังก์ชันส่งคืนบางสิ่งแทนที่ หรือจัดการเป้าหมายในทางใดทางหนึ่ง

คำถามคือทำไมมัณฑนากรถึงใช้เชิงมุม?

ระดับ มัณฑนากร ทำให้เราได้บอกต่อ เชิงมุม ว่าคลาสใดเป็นส่วนประกอบหรือโมดูล เป็นต้น และ มัณฑนากร ช่วยให้เราสามารถกำหนดเจตนานี้โดยไม่ต้องใส่โค้ดใดๆ ลงในชั้นเรียนจริงๆ ไม่ต้องใช้รหัสในชั้นเรียนเพื่อบอก เชิงมุม ว่าเป็นส่วนประกอบหรือโมดูล

มัณฑนากรและคำสั่งในเชิงมุมคืออะไร?

ใน เชิงมุม , NS คำสั่ง เป็นคลาส typescript ที่มีคำอธิบายประกอบด้วย TypeScript มัณฑนากร . NS มัณฑนากร เป็นสัญลักษณ์ @ มัณฑนากร ไม่ได้เป็นส่วนหนึ่งของฟังก์ชัน JavaScript ในขณะนี้ (แม้ว่าจะมีแนวโน้มว่าจะเกิดขึ้นในอนาคต) และยังคงเป็นรุ่นทดลองใน TypeScript